Jarrett Buckles Up -- Avoids Injury

Devon Pollard, TrojanWire

Dwayne Jarrett, who usually tries to avoid safeties on the field, luckily found it behind the wheel. Ex-USC, and Carolina Panthers' receiver Jarret was involved in a car accident Wednesday night, reports Pat Yasinskas of the Charlotte Observer.

After the initial news release Scout.com contacted Jarrett's manager, Darin Morgan, to confirm the accident had taken place.

Morgan had this to say:

"At this point, it appears that Dwayne only has bumps and bruises. Dwayne has consulted with the Panthers' medical personnel and we will continue to monitor his medical situation.

Dwayne and I talked soon after the accident and thank goodness he was wearing his seatbelt and wasn't seriously hurt."

It always pays to buckle up for safety. A PSA from Dwayne Jarrett and TrojanWire.
